Transaction 65eae75db19ac9dd609708b0eb426d0d8bcc2c0d082563bae11ffeea58d15127
1 Input
1 Output
-
65eae75db19ac9dd609708b0eb426d0d8bcc2c0d082563bae11ffeea58d15127:0
- value
- 567510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94b7a63ef256443afafcc416a849543059e75e58 OP_EQUAL
- address
- 3FFMw7pz93HJqtdrJmXtVXiSZSchgKQWsT